If y/x = 1/3 and x + 2y = 10, then x is

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back



If y/x = 1/3 and x + 2y = 10, then x is..

Answer / s.rajendran

Given:
y/x = 1/3
x+2y = 10

Solution:
if y/x = 1/3, then
x = 3y
therefore, 3y + 2y = 10
so, y = 10/5 = 2
substitute y = 2 in x + 2y = 10
therefore, x + 4 = 10
it gives the answer x = 6

x = 6.
